    Luana Santos calls bantamweight return at UFC Vegas 106 a ‘shortcut’ to title fight

    Luana Santos began her UFC profession as a flyweight, however her future could also be at bantamweight. At 25, she returns to the 135-pound division to face Tainara Lisboa at UFC Vegas 106 on Saturday trying to make an vital choice.

    Santos was booked to struggle as soon as earlier than at bantamweight within the UFC, however badly missed the goal, coming in at practically 140 kilos. Doctors discovered the young Brazilian had Hashimoto’s disease, an autoimmune situation that may result in weight achieve by affecting the thyroid gland. Santos took treatment to get the illness beneath management and she or he went 1-1 as a flyweight, nevertheless it simply made sense to return to bantamweight after combating abdomen points earlier than and after the lower for her current bout with Casey O’Neill.

    On high of that, Santos sees the bantamweight class as being so shallow it may imply a faster rise to the highest.

    “Not that it’s simpler… however it’s,” Santos advised MMA Combating. “I feel the 125 division is extra aggressive than 135. And if I can struggle at 135, why not take the shortcut? For instance, Tainara was ranked after solely two fights within the UFC. She didn’t beat anybody related to be ranked. It’s simpler to climb [the ranking] at 135 than 125. If I’ve the energy and measurement to be at 135, why proceed battling my physique to chop to 125 if I’m solely 25 and will certainly not be a flyweight sooner or later?”

    Santos’ choice shouldn’t be set in stone but. A future at bantamweight is dependent upon her efficiency in opposition to Lisboa and probably her subsequent struggle, however the transfer is sensible proper now.

    “I’m not a small lady for 135. Fairly the other,” Santos mentioned. “I fought at 135 earlier than and I’ll attempt that once more. Let’s see the way it goes. If I win this one and the following, let’s do it. All of it is dependent upon how the struggle goes and the way I really feel in there.”

    Lisboa is older than Santos and hasn’t fought in 18 months on account of a battle with a career-threatening left knee harm. Santos gained’t overlook her opponent, however sees the state of affairs as extra favorable for her at UFC Vegas 106.

    “I feel Tainara is a really powerful and skilled lady,” Santos mentioned. “She’s nearly 10 years older than me but when we’re speaking MMA, we’ve nearly the identical expertise. Her putting is extra Muay Thai oriented, she has good jiu-jitsu, however I feel I could be superior than her in that space. The 2 losses she had had been in opposition to ladies who’ve accomplished that kind of sport.”

    “I feel it’s an awesome matchup,” she added. “She’s coming off a knee harm and I don’t understand how her head will likely be after greater than a yr off. I feel she’s powerful. I don’t assume it’s going to be a simple struggle, however I feel there’s an awesome likelihood I come out with the win.”
